About the Role

About the role:

We are currently recruiting for a creative and dedicated Art Teacher to join a Pupil Referral Unit (PRU) in Manchester on a full-time, long-term basis starting in September. This is a rewarding opportunity for a passionate educator who is committed to supporting young people who may face barriers to mainstream education. The successful candidate will use art and creativity as a tool to engage students, build confidence, encourage self-expression, and support both academic and personal development within a structured and supportive learning environment.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Plan and deliver engaging Art lessons tailored to the individual needs of KS3 and KS4 pupils.
  • Use creative approaches to promote engagement, confidence, and emotional wellbeing.
  • Create a positive and inclusive classroom environment that supports learning and personal growth.
  • Assess, monitor, and track pupil progress, adapting lessons where necessary to meet individual needs.
  • Work collaboratively with support staff, parents, and external professionals to achieve the best outcomes for students.

 

Pre-requisites:

  •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or equivalent recognised teaching qualification.
  • Experience teaching Art at secondary level.
  • Strong behaviour management and relationship-building skills.
  • Ability to engage and motivate students who may be disengaged from education.
  • Enhanced DBS on the Update Service or willingness to obtain one.
